Australians intend to work longer than ever before

on Wednesday, March 30, 2016

Australians aged 45 years and over are intending to work longer than ever before, according to figures released by the Australian Bureau of Statistics (ABS) today. In the survey conducted in 2014-15, 71 per cent of persons intended to retire at the age of 65 years or over, up from 66 per cent in last survey result of 2012-13 and 48 per cent in 2004-05.

Benetas retirement village to provide affordable housing for Bendigo seniors

on Friday, January 19, 2024

Benetas will soon begin refurbishing ageing independent living units located within the St Laurence Court Retirement Village in California Gully. The existing units, built around 1960, will be converted into 38 two-bedroom units to be used as affordable housing for people aged 55 and older. Residents will also have access to communal facilities within the site.
